Transaction afaae2039ec91f92e1115982e93e406c87eec2675a42f2dddf71afd959d6f1db
1 Input
2 Outputs
- afaae2039ec91f92e1115982e93e406c87eec2675a42f2dddf71afd959d6f1db:0
- afaae2039ec91f92e1115982e93e406c87eec2675a42f2dddf71afd959d6f1db:1
value 11220745
address 32fCyhwMaGw4hz1fF5egiKDjfec7EGkcDw
value 12000000
address 3EsgSmxEKUmz1kn7Yb2nr7JsofaRjsnsdx